PHILADELPHIA (WPVI) -- A ground stop was in effect at Philadelphia International Airport, but has since been lifted.

That meant flights trying to get to Philadelphia were delayed at various airports.

At least 50 flights have been canceled, and several others delayed.

Airport officials are urging passengers to call their carriers for flight information.

SEPTA has weather-related detours in effect for bus routes 18, 24, 42, K, R, H and XH.

The Pennsylvania Turnpike temporarily lowered the speed limit on the entire toll road system.

Speeds were reduced to 45 mph, but are back to normal on all Pennsylvania Turnpike sections.
